Michael Barbaro created and hosts The Daily, the wildly popular five-day-a-week podcast from The New York Times. Since its creation in 2017, at the beginning of the Trump presidency, The Daily has become the most popular news podcast in the world, with more than 3 million listeners.

The Daily has won a DuPont-Columbia University Award for audio excellence and has been named a top podcast of the year by Time, Entertainment Weekly, The Atlantic, Esquire, Adweek, The New Yorker, and New York Magazine.

Before hosting The Daily, Barbaro was a national political correspondent for The New York Times and host of The Run-Up, a podcast about the 2016 presidential race. Previously, he covered New York's City Hall and the U.S. retail industry. Upon graduation with a bachelor’s degree in history from Yale in 2002, he joined The Washington Post as a reporter covering the biotechnology industry, eventually joining The New York Times in 2005.
